In recent years, the competition in Malaysia's C-Segment electric vehicle market has become increasingly intense, and the demand for long range and high configuration among family users continues to rise. The recently launched 2023 BYD ATTO 3 Anniversary Special Edition is targeting this niche market. As an anniversary special edition model, it not only retains the Extended Range version’s official range of 480km but also optimizes configuration details while being priced only 6,000 MYR higher than the latter. The main purpose of this test drive is to evaluate the practicality, performance, and configuration value of this special edition model in daily use to see if it is worth the extra budget for consumers.

From the exterior, the Anniversary Special Edition remains consistent with the Extended Range version, with an overall style leaning toward youthful and dynamic. The front features a closed grille design, complemented by sharp LED headlights on both sides. The daytime running lights inside the headlights are L-shaped, providing high recognition. The vehicle's side profile shows smooth lines with a refined 18-inch multi-spoke wheel design and 215/55 R18 tires that are well-proportioned to the body. At the rear, the through-type LED taillights are a visual highlight, offering a striking lighting effect. Below that is a simple-designed rear bumper without overly complex lines. The overall dimensions of the vehicle are 4455mm in length, 1875mm in width, 1615mm in height, and a 2720mm wheelbase, which fits the standard size of the C-Segment. From the side, the vehicle appears relatively elongated.

Inside the cabin, the interior adopts a minimalist and modern design style, with a 12.8-inch rotatable touchscreen at the center of the dashboard. The touch responsiveness is excellent, supporting commonly used functions such as navigation, multimedia, and vehicle settings. The interior materials mainly consist of soft-touch surfaces, with leather wrapping around the armrest box and inner sides of the door panels, providing a comfortable touch. The instrument panel is a fully digital display, offering clear information on speed, range, battery level, etc., while the HUD head-up display can project key data onto the windshield, reducing the need to look away while driving. In terms of configuration, the special edition comes equipped with electrically adjustable front seats (6-way for the driver and 4-way for the passenger), independent rear air conditioning vents, 220V/230V power outlets, as well as keyless entry and start functions, enhancing daily convenience.

In terms of space, the 2720mm wheelbase provides notable advantages in the rear row. A 175cm passenger seated in the rear has about two fists of legroom left and one fist of headroom, avoiding any sense of confinement. The trunk volume is 440L, easily accommodating two 28-inch suitcases. The rear seats support a 60:40 split fold, which can be expanded to create more storage space, meeting the needs of family trips or transporting large items. The cabin provides ample storage compartments, including door panel slots, a storage box under the center console, and the central armrest box, all of which are practical for placing phones, water bottles, and other small items.

In terms of power, the Anniversary Special Edition is equipped with a front-mounted permanent magnet synchronous motor with a maximum power of 150kW (205PS) and a maximum torque of 310N·m. The official 0-100km/h acceleration time is 7.3 seconds. During actual driving, the power response is quick at the start. Just a light press on the accelerator provides a noticeable push-back feeling. On urban roads, overtaking and changing lanes are relatively easy. The driving modes include Eco, Standard, and Sport. In Eco mode, the power output is relatively moderate, suitable for daily commutes; while in Sport mode, the power response is more aggressive, catering to scenarios that require rapid acceleration. The battery capacity is 60.48kWh, with an official range of 480km. During this test drive on mixed roads (approximately 60% urban roads and 40% highways), the actual range realization rate was about 85%, with an energy consumption of approximately 15kWh per 100 kilometers, which meets expectations.

In terms of handling and chassis, the combination of front MacPherson independent suspension + rear multi-link independent suspension performs well when dealing with urban bumpy roads, effectively filtering out most of the fine vibrations, resulting in good comfort for rear passengers. When driving at high speeds, the body stability is strong, the steering precision is accurate with minimal dead angle, and the body roll is maintained within a reasonable range during cornering without any noticeable swaying feeling. As for braking, the front ventilated disc brakes and rear disc brakes offer a linear braking effect, and during emergency braking, the vehicle remains stable without drifting issues.

Regarding ride comfort, the vehicle’s noise control is well-executed, with wind and tire noise being minimal at high speeds, and the electric motor operates very quietly. The energy recovery system offers three adjustable levels, with the highest level providing strong regenerative braking that gives a noticeable deceleration upon releasing the accelerator, making it suitable for users accustomed to a single-pedal driving mode. The lowest level closely resembles the coasting feel of fuel vehicles, making it easier to adapt. The seats offer good wrapping and support, ensuring that long drives don’t lead to fatigue, while the cushioning in the rear seats is equally soft, providing a high degree of comfort for passengers.

Overall, the 2023 BYD ATTO 3 Anniversary Special Edition's core strengths lie in its long range, rich features, and well-balanced dynamic performance. Compared to the Model Y Standard Range in the same segment, it is more affordable and better equipped; when compared to local electric vehicle brands, its range and performance are more advantageous. Although the Special Edition is priced 6,000 MYR higher than the Extended Range version, the detailed configuration upgrades (such as seat adjustments and minor tweaks to the air conditioning system) enhance the user experience, maintaining its outstanding value for money.

This model is suitable for families that prioritize range and features, as it meets the requirements for daily commuting and weekend family outings. At the same time, young consumers looking for performance and advanced technology features will also find a pleasant driving experience. Overall, the Anniversary Special Edition is a well-balanced C-segment electric vehicle with strong competitiveness in its price range.

Previously, I drove a fuel-powered SUV, and with Malaysia's fuel prices, the monthly fuel cost exceeded RM500. After switching to the ATTO 3 Long Range version, the electricity cost reduced by half! During the morning rush hour on the LDP highway, the single-pedal driving mode makes following traffic super convenient, and the automatic braking system once helped me avoid a sudden brake from the car in front. On weekends, I take my family to the foothills of Genting. With a 2720mm wheelbase, the rear seats are spacious, and after a round trip with the 60.48kWh battery, there's still 100km of range left. The safety features are comprehensive, with 6 airbags and lane-keeping assistance, making it feel much safer than my old car. A small downside is that the rotating central control screen occasionally lags, but overall, I am very satisfied—4 stars for safety, performance, and appearance, with excellent value for money!

After driving the ATTO 3 long-range version for half a year, commuting in traffic every day, it never lags behind fuel cars when starting or overtaking. With the air conditioning fully on, the range lasts a week without charging. The back row comfortably seats three friends, and the trunk fits camping gear. The only slight regret is the lack of lane change assist in the safety features.

Last Saturday, I took my family to the orchard at the foot of Genting Mountain. While climbing the slope, stepping hard on the accelerator gave a strong acceleration sensation of 7.3 seconds. It was indeed powerful, and overtaking was clean and decisive. However, the 2090kg weight of the car made the body roll in consecutive curves quite noticeable, so deducting 1 point for performance is fair. The 12.8-inch screen in the interior has clear navigation, and the HUD allows you to check the speed without lowering your head. However, the 4-way adjustment for the co-driver seat is not sufficient, so giving 4 points is reasonable. The exterior design has an eye-catching appeal, and giving it 5 points is well-deserved.
